How much do auto finance product strategy manager jobs pay per year?

As of Sep 13, 2026, the average yearly pay for auto finance product strategy manager in the United States is $159,405.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$141,000.00 and $197,000.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

Financial Recovery Technologies (FRT) is a trusted partner to institutional investors, leveraging technology, legal expertise, and operational scale to deliver best-in-class recovery solutions.We are seeking a Director of Product Strategy to lead our Wealth line of business. This role will define and execute a market-driven product strategy to drive revenue and client growth across private banks, broker-dealers, RIAs, and other wealth market segments.
As a Director of Product Strategy at FRT, you will operate as an individual contributor with broad ownership and autonomy, partnering closely with product management, sales, marketing, client service, and delivery teams to take ideas from concept through commercial launch.
Specifically, as the Director of Product Strategy, you will:
Define the Wealth Market Opportunity
  • Build and maintain a clear view of the wealth management landscape
  • Identify and prioritize sub-segments based on product-market fit, operational realities, and revenue potential
  • Lead market discovery with prospective clients, partners, and advisors to surface pain points, workflow gaps, and unmet needs
  • Maintain an active view of the competitive landscape, identifying where FRT can differentiate
  • Translate Market Insight into Product Strategy
  • Define the product strategy for the Wealth line of business, anchored in clear client value and business impact
Translate FRT capabilities into defined solutions that reflect client workflows and can be packaged, priced, and sold
  • Develop business cases and high-level requirements that shape product direction and inform go/no-go decisions
  • Partner with product management, which owns detailed requirements and execution, to move opportunities from concept to launch
  • Balance speed to market with development of high-value features that support long-term growth
  • Contribute to the evolution of the product portfolio across both new opportunities and existing offerings

Drive Commercialization and Growth

  • Lead commercialization efforts for Wealth solutions, including packaging, positioning, and pricing in partnership with marketing and sales
  • Act as the subject matter expert for the Wealth line of business, supporting sales and client service in client discussions and deal support
  • Ensure consistent messaging of value across client-facing teams
  • Measure success through adoption, launch effectiveness, and revenue growth within the Wealth segment
